Yashi CLI for Jinja2 template renderer Dockerfile set-up
The Docker WORKDIR
is at /app
, and the entrypoint starts with yashi
, and
therefore only the arguments to yashi
should be part of the command.
You are recommended to use stdin and stdout to run yasha
.
cat ./app.conf.j2 \
| docker run -i \
-v "$PWD/vars/":/app/vars/ \
guangie88/yasha:latest \
-v /app/vars/dev.toml - \
> ./app.conf
The above command assumes that both the Jinja2 template file app.conf.j2
, and
the value file ./vars/dev.toml
exist. It applies the values from
./vars/dev.toml
to app.conf.j2
, and writes the output to app.conf
.
